Hello gang… I have exported a Blocs project as Pulse, but now need to RE-EXPORT is as a NON-PULSE format, just HTML. When I try to do that, Blocs freezes upon export. Anyone know how to revert a project back to regular HTML? @Norm? Thanks in advance for any help or suggestions, Randy

SOLVED. While I had no content wrapped as Pulse objects, I did see that in the Project settings, under “Project CMS”, I had Pulse selected in the dropdown. By changing that to “All Available” it reverted back to a non-CMS state and I was able to export it normally as HTML. Warm Regards, Randy
